The Maitland Chemistry Park in Augusta Township is capitalizing on new opportunities as Evonik Canada and INVISTA invest $31 million to reintroduce new and returning products. The investment brings exciting opportunities to the Leeds Grenville region. Presenters Greg Canning-LeBlanc, Plant Manager, Maitland Hydrogen Peroxide, Evonik Canada and INVISTA (Canada) Company's Maitland Site Manager Matthew Murton will present on collaboration and growth.

Cam Heaps, Founder / Chief Executive Officer, Voltari Marine Electric will share exciting details on Voltari Marine Electric's commercial fleet launch. Headquartered in Merrickville, Voltari is a global leader in marine technology with a collaborative team of visionaries.

Potentia Renewables Inc.. Chief Executive Officer Ben Greenhouse and Senior Project Manager will speak on The Skyview 2 Battery Energy Storage Project in the Township of Edwardsburgh Cardinal.


Providing up to 411MW to improve Ontario’s electrical grid, the $750 million facility will play a pivotal role in meeting energy demand and storage capabilities.
